This program and the accompanying materials * are made available under the terms of the Eclipse Public License v1.0 * which accompanies this distribution, and is available at * http://www.eclipse.org/legal/epl-v10.html * * Contributors: * IBM Corporation - initial API and implementation *******************************************************************************/ package org.eclipse.core.internal.events; import java.util.EventObject; import org.eclipse.core.resources.IPathVariableChangeEvent; import org.eclipse.core.resources.IPathVariableManager; import org.eclipse.core.runtime.IPath; /** * Describes a change in path variable. Core's default implementation for the * <code>IPathVariableChangeEvent</code> interface. */ public class PathVariableChangeEvent extends EventObject implements IPathVariableChangeEvent { private static final long serialVersionUID= 1L; /** * The name of the changed variable. */ private String variableName; /** * The value of the changed variable (may be null). */ private IPath value; /** The event type. */ private int type; /** * Constructor for this class. */ public PathVariableChangeEvent(IPathVariableManager source, String variableName, IPath value, int type) { super(source); if (type < VARIABLE_CHANGED || type > VARIABLE_DELETED) throw new IllegalArgumentException("Invalid event type: " + type); //$NON-NLS-1$ this.variableName= variableName; this.value= value; this.type= type; } /** * @see org.eclipse.core.resources.IPathVariableChangeEvent#getValue() */ public IPath getValue() { return value; } /** * @see org.eclipse.core.resources.IPathVariableChangeEvent#getVariableName() */ public String getVariableName() { return variableName; } /** * @see org.eclipse.core.resources.IPathVariableChangeEvent#getType() */ public int getType() { return type; } /** * Return a string representation of this object. */ public String toString() { String[] typeStrings= { "VARIABLE_CHANGED", "VARIABLE_CREATED", "VARIABLE_DELETED" }; //$NON-NLS-1$ //$NON-NLS-2$ //$NON-NLS-3$ StringBuffer sb= new StringBuffer(getClass().getName()); sb.append("[variable = "); //$NON-NLS-1$ sb.append(variableName); sb.append(", type = "); //$NON-NLS-1$ sb.append(typeStrings[type - 1]); if (type != VARIABLE_DELETED) { sb.append(", value = "); //$NON-NLS-1$ sb.append(value); } sb.append("]"); //$NON-NLS-1$ return sb.toString(); } }
